Ghana Table Tennis Association continues to make strides in the global sports arena with the election of its president Mawuko Afadzinu as the first Chairman of the Sustainability Committee of the International Table Tennis Federation.
Afadzinu, who is also a Board Member of the International Table Tennis Federation, will be assisted by Daniel Valero of Spain and Majd Albalooshi of the United Arab Emirates.
In partnership with the International Table Tennis Federation’s Foundation, the Committee will ensure that the international body champions a greener future by fulfilling its needs without compromising the ability of future generations to do so by balancing not just the environmental factors, but the social and economic factors to create a healthy, equitable, and prosperous society.
Afadzinu and his team will serve a two-year term from 2023 to 2025.
At the just-ended International Table Tennis Federation’s Seminar in Bangkok, Thailand from the 22nd to 24th of August 2023, Afadzinu also led a workshop on growing revenues for national, regional and continental table tennis events.
